quantum cryptography

PQC for the RPKI

Author image
Dirk Doesburg

27 min read

Future capabilities of quantum attackers will present a host of new vulnerabilities for RPKI. A research student from SIDN Labs presents the first work on post-quantum cryptography for the RPKI, establishing the foundation for making this critical Internet infrastructure quantum-safe.

Analysing Malicious Domains with RIPE Atlas

Author image
Guillermo Pereyra

10 min read

Taking down malicious websites means understanding which geographical regions or IP ranges can access them. RIPE Atlas can help collect the technical evidence needed to determine the geographic reach of a malicious site and provide accurate, location-based reports for its takedown.
